Transaction 194e76a56fa6daf72a04c13f21ed588344c540503eab44fc548052b127d37979
1 Input
1 Output
-
194e76a56fa6daf72a04c13f21ed588344c540503eab44fc548052b127d37979:0
- value
- 19945893
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 76016db0d98b0a8db5041ead2503cbe5f71916a1 OP_EQUAL
- address
- 3CSyNS2NF9udjdpXzYYiNVMMR9QotVzhfH